palatopharyngoplasty

DEFINITIONS OF: palatopharyngoplasty

1

n surgical resection of unnecessary palatal and oropharyngeal tissue to open the airway; intended to cure extreme cases of snoring (with or without sleep apnea)

Synonyms:
PPP, UPPP, uvulopalatopharyngoplasty
Type of:
operation, surgery, surgical operation, surgical procedure, surgical process
a medical procedure involving an incision with instruments; performed to repair damage or arrest disease in a living body
